SAMUEL PACK, JUNIOR - 135 acres - GILES CO., VA

Wilson Cary Nicholas Esquire, Governor of the Commonwealth of Virginia, to all
to whom these presents com, Greetings: Know ye that in conformity with a
survey made the 24th day of July, 1813, by virtue of a Land Office Treasury
Warrant, No. 4837, issued the 11th of February, 1812; there is granted by the
said Commonwealth unto SAMUEL PACK, junior, a certain tract or parcel of land,
containing one hundred and thirty five acres, situated in the County of Giles,
on the waters of CooperÂ’s Creek and bounded as followeth, to wit. Beginning
at three white oaks on the top of a ridge, near the state road, thence north
seven degrees west eight one poles crossing said creek to two white oaks;
north ninety nine degrees west one hundred and four poles to two white oaks;
south twenty six degrees west forty two poles to two white oaks, on the point
of a ridge; south thirty eight degrees west, eighteen poles to a white oak and
spanish oak, and the forks of a branch; south forty six degrees west, one
hundred poles crossing one fork of the branch to two white oaks; and a
ironwood; south eighteen degrees west, sixty three poles to four chestnuts on
a flat ridge and thence north seventy two degrees west two hundred poles to
the beginning with its appurtenances: To have and to hold the said tract or
parcel of land with its appurtenances, to the said SAMUEL PACK, junior and his
heirs forever. In witness whereof, the said Wilson Cary Nicholas, Esquire,
Governor of the Commonwealth of Virginia, hath hereunto set his hand and
caused the lesser seal of the said Commonwealth to be affixed at Richmond, on
the twenty sixth day of April in the year of our Lord, one thousand eight
hundred and fifteen, and of the Commonwealth the thirty ninth.

W. C. Nicholas
(his signature)

Grant Book No. 65
1815-1816
Page 96
